Non-linear finite element modeling of damages in bridge piers subjected to lateral monotonic loading

Aizaz Ahmad,
Awais Ahmed,
Mudassir Iqbal
et al.

Abstract: Bridges are among the most vulnerable structures to earthquake damage. Most bridges are seismically inadequate due to outdated bridge design codes and poor construction methods in developing countries. Although expensive, experimental studies are useful in evaluating bridge piers. As an alternative, numerical tools are used to evaluate bridge piers, and many numerical techniques can be applied in this context.
